The Turkish frigate “TCG Oruçreis” is making a port visit to the Norfolk Naval Base between June 14-21 to participate in the “FLEETEX-250/2026” exercise, which will be conducted as part of the events marking the 250th anniversary of the founding of the United States.
“Elchi” reports that the Turkish Ministry of National Defense shared this information on its “X” social media account.
“The TCG Oruçreis frigate was welcomed on June 14, 2026, by Naval Fleet Commander Rear Admiral Mehmet Baybars Küçükatay, Norfolk Turkish Senior Officer Major General Hayrettin Koca, and Washington Naval Attaché Haluk Orhon,” the statement said.
